The Hassidic Definition of "Meshuga"

I must admit that this is not mine; I found it in the comment section of a Jblog:

A pious hasid went to his redde and told him a tale of woe:

"My son has become meshuga (crazy). He eats chazir (pork) and dances with shiksas (gentile women)."

The rebbe looked at the hasid and said,

"What you described doesn't make your son meshuga. Now if you said that he ate shiksas and danced with chazir, then I would say that he was meshuga."
